jspページについてjstlを使用する異常分析
2445 ワード
1.jspページでは下記のコードを使ってjstlのサポートを入れます.
org.apache.jasperException:java.lag.lassNotFoundException:org.aparthe.jsp.ctomer.addCutomer Info_jsp
org.apache.jasper.servlet.JspServletWrapper.get Servlet(JspServletWrapper.java:177)
org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:369)
org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:390)
org.apache.jasper.servlet.JspServlet.service(JspServlet.java:334)
javax.servlet.http.HttpServlet.service(HttpServlet.java:722)
org.springframe ebook.orm.hibernate 3.support.OpenSession InVieFilter.doFilter Internal(OpenSession InVieFilter.java:198)
org.springframe ework.web.filter.OnecePerRequest Filter.doFilter(OnecePerRequest Filter.java:76)
org.springframe ework.web.filter.character EncerEncocdingFilter.dofilter Internal(CharcterEncodingFilter.java:96)
org.springframe ework.web.filter.OnecePerRequest Filter.doFilter(OnecePerRequest Filter.java:76)
root cause
java.lag.lassNotFoundException:org.apache.jsp.Coustomer.addCustomer Info_jsp
java.net.URLClassLoader$1.run(URLClassLoader.java:200)
java.security.Access Controller.doPrivileged(Native Method)
java.net.URLClassLoader.findClass(URLClassLoader.java:188)
org.apache.jasper.servlet.JasperLoader.loadClass(JasperLoader.java:132)
org.apache.jasper.servlet.Jasper Loader.loadClass(JasperLoader.java:63)
org.apache.jasper.servlet.JspServletWrapper.get Servlet(JspServletWrapper.java:172)
org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:369)
org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:390)
org.apache.jasper.servlet.JspServlet.service(JspServlet.java:334)
javax.servlet.http.HttpServlet.service(HttpServlet.java:722)
org.springframe ebook.orm.hibernate 3.support.OpenSession InVieFilter.doFilter Internal(OpenSession InVieFilter.java:198)
org.springframe ework.web.filter.OnecePerRequest Filter.doFilter(OnecePerRequest Filter.java:76)
org.sprigfr
amework.web.filter.Character EncerEncocdingFilter.dofilterInternal(ChracterEncodingFilter.java:96)
org.springframe ework.web.filter.OnecePerRequest Filter.doFilter(OnecePerRequest Filter.java:76)
あなたのTomcatのlibディレクトリにはjstlのjarパッケージがないため、tomcatがjstlを解析できなくなります.
解決策:tomcatのlibディレクトリにjstlのjarパッケージを追加すればいいです.
jstl jar包下载地址:下载jstl
2.jspページに以下のような異常があればorg.apache.jasperException:java.lag.lassNotFoundException:org.aparthe.jsp.ctomer.addCutomer Info_jsp
org.apache.jasper.servlet.JspServletWrapper.get Servlet(JspServletWrapper.java:177)
org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:369)
org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:390)
org.apache.jasper.servlet.JspServlet.service(JspServlet.java:334)
javax.servlet.http.HttpServlet.service(HttpServlet.java:722)
org.springframe ebook.orm.hibernate 3.support.OpenSession InVieFilter.doFilter Internal(OpenSession InVieFilter.java:198)
org.springframe ework.web.filter.OnecePerRequest Filter.doFilter(OnecePerRequest Filter.java:76)
org.springframe ework.web.filter.character EncerEncocdingFilter.dofilter Internal(CharcterEncodingFilter.java:96)
org.springframe ework.web.filter.OnecePerRequest Filter.doFilter(OnecePerRequest Filter.java:76)
root cause
java.lag.lassNotFoundException:org.apache.jsp.Coustomer.addCustomer Info_jsp
java.net.URLClassLoader$1.run(URLClassLoader.java:200)
java.security.Access Controller.doPrivileged(Native Method)
java.net.URLClassLoader.findClass(URLClassLoader.java:188)
org.apache.jasper.servlet.JasperLoader.loadClass(JasperLoader.java:132)
org.apache.jasper.servlet.Jasper Loader.loadClass(JasperLoader.java:63)
org.apache.jasper.servlet.JspServletWrapper.get Servlet(JspServletWrapper.java:172)
org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:369)
org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:390)
org.apache.jasper.servlet.JspServlet.service(JspServlet.java:334)
javax.servlet.http.HttpServlet.service(HttpServlet.java:722)
org.springframe ebook.orm.hibernate 3.support.OpenSession InVieFilter.doFilter Internal(OpenSession InVieFilter.java:198)
org.springframe ework.web.filter.OnecePerRequest Filter.doFilter(OnecePerRequest Filter.java:76)
org.sprigfr
amework.web.filter.Character EncerEncocdingFilter.dofilterInternal(ChracterEncodingFilter.java:96)
org.springframe ework.web.filter.OnecePerRequest Filter.doFilter(OnecePerRequest Filter.java:76)
あなたのTomcatのlibディレクトリにはjstlのjarパッケージがないため、tomcatがjstlを解析できなくなります.
解決策:tomcatのlibディレクトリにjstlのjarパッケージを追加すればいいです.
jstl jar包下载地址:下载jstl